Hot Pepper Pecans

Cook: 30 min Cuisine: American

Hot Pepper Pecans offer a savory, spicy snack with a rich buttery flavor accented by soy sauce and Tabasco. Perfect for entertaining or a flavorful treat, these pecans are crispy, seasoned, and keep well for weeks, making them an ideal gift or snack for those who enjoy a bit of heat.

Ingredients

  • large pecan halves
  • butter
  • soy sauce
  • salt
  • Tabasco sauce

Instructions

  1. For each cup of large pecans, melt 2 tablespoons of butter in a shallow pan.
  2. Spread the pecans evenly in the bottom of the pan.
  3. Bake at 300°F for 30 minutes, stirring several times during baking.
  4. Mix 2 teaspoons soy sauce, 1/2 teaspoon salt, and 3 or 4 dashes of Tabasco sauce into the toasted pecans.
  5. Pack into jars with tight lids for storage.
